What companies run services between Harrogate, England and Brecon, Wales?

You can take a train from Harrogate to Brecon Interchange 4 via Leeds, Manchester Piccadilly, Abergavenny, and Station Road in around 6h 47m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Library Gardens to Bulwark via Leeds Bus Station Entrance, Leeds City Bus & Coach Station, Birmingham Coach Station, and Bay Campus in around 11h 21m.
